Product Description

The Panametrics PanaFlow MV82 is an insertion-style multivariable vortex flow meter engineered for accurate measurement of mass flow, volumetric flow, temperature, pressure, and density in a single compact instrument. Its multivariable design integrates a vortex shedding velocity sensor, a 1000 ohm platinum RTD temperature sensor, and a solid-state pressure transducer, all housed in a single sensor head assembly located downstream of the shedder bar.

By measuring velocity, temperature, and pressure at the same point in the pipeline, the MV82 eliminates the inaccuracies caused by using separate devices installed at different locations. This single-point measurement approach significantly improves process measurement accuracy, particularly in applications where process conditions may vary spatially.

The MV82 is available in several configurations to match specific application requirements:

  • MV82-VTP: Full multivariable version with flow computer functionality, incorporating temperature and pressure sensors for compensated mass flow of gases, liquids, and steam. Provides up to three 4-20 mA outputs for five process measurements including volumetric flow, mass flow, pressure, temperature, and density.
  • MV82-VT: Integrates a precision 1000 ohm platinum RTD for compensated mass flow reading, typically used for saturated steam applications.
  • MV82-V: Direct volumetric flow measurement, the most cost-effective solution for liquid flow monitoring including water and hydrocarbon fuels.
  • MV82-EM: Energy monitoring option enabling real-time calculation of energy consumption for steam, hot water, or chilled water systems. Uses inputs from two temperature sensors to calculate delta T and energy total in selectable units including BTU, joules, calories, watt-hours, megawatt-hours, and horsepower-hours.

Accuracy specifications are ±1.2% for liquid mass flow and ±1.5% for gas and steam mass flow. Volumetric flow accuracy is ±1.5% for liquids and ±2% for gases and steam. Temperature accuracy is ±2°F (±1°C), pressure accuracy is ±0.3% of full scale, and density accuracy ranges from ±0.3% to ±0.5% of reading depending on fluid type.

The standard temperature range is -40°C to 260°C, with a high-temperature option extending to 400°C for demanding applications. Pressure rating is 30 to 1500 psi, and the meter is suitable for pipe sizes from 2 to 72 inches.

The meter features an advanced design with digital signal processing for vibration isolation, ensuring reliable operation even in challenging industrial environments. Installation options include fixed or retractable configurations for hot or cold tapping, with process connections available in compression or packing gland styles with 2" NPT or flanged ANSI 150/300/600 connections.

Communication capabilities include HART and Modbus protocols, enabling seamless integration with DCS and SCADA systems. A local LCD display with six-button keypad provides convenient on-site configuration and monitoring. Power options include 18-36 VDC or optional AC power.

The PanaFlow MV82 is certified for hazardous locations with FM, ATEX, and IECEx approvals for Division 1/Zone 1 explosive atmospheres.

Typical applications include high-temperature and high-velocity steam measurement, power generation, HVAC and district energy management, natural gas allocation, and petrochemical mass balancing.

Product Specifications

Manufacturer:Panametrics

Product Number:MV82 Series

Type:Insertion Multivariable Vortex Flow Meter

Available Configurations:MV82-VTP, MV82-VT, MV82-V, MV82-EM

Measured Variables:Volumetric flow, mass flow, temperature, pressure, density

Fluid Types:Liquids, gases, steam

Accuracy (Liquid Mass Flow):±1.2% of rate

Accuracy (Gas/Steam Mass Flow):±1.5% of rate

Accuracy (Liquid Volumetric Flow):±1.5% of rate

Accuracy (Gas/Steam Volumetric Flow):±2% of rate

Accuracy (Temperature):±2°F (±1°C)

Accuracy (Pressure):±0.3% of full scale

Accuracy (Density - Liquids):±0.3% of reading

Accuracy (Density - Gas/Steam):±0.5% of reading

Repeatability (Mass Flow):±0.2% of rate

Repeatability (Volumetric Flow):±0.1% of rate

Repeatability (Temperature):±0.2°F (±0.1°C)

Repeatability (Pressure):±0.05% of full scale

Repeatability (Density):±0.1% of reading

Temperature Range (Standard):-40°C to 260°C (-40°F to 500°F)

Temperature Range (High Temp Option):-40°C to 400°C (-40°F to 752°F)

Pressure Range:30 to 1500 psi (2 to 103 bar)

Pipe Size Range:2 to 72 inches (50 to 1800 mm)

Temperature Sensor:1000 ohm platinum RTD

Pressure Sensor:Solid-state pressure transducer

Outputs:Up to 3 x 4-20 mA analog outputs, scaled pulse output

Communication Protocols:HART, Modbus

Display:LCD digital display with 6-button keypad

Power:18-36 VDC, 100 mA typical; optional AC powered unit available

Process Connections:Compression or packing gland, 2" NPT or flanged ANSI 150/300/600

Installation:Fixed or retractable (hot/cold tap)

Wetted Materials:316 stainless steel, PTFE/graphite

Hazardous Area Approvals:FM, ATEX, IECEx for Division 1/Zone 1
